In 2018, Denise M. Demeter earned a total compensation of $1.3M as Vice President, Chief Human Resources Officer at Graham Holdings, a 18% increase compared to previous year.

Compensation breakdown

Change in Pension Value and Nonqualified Deferred Compensation Earnings$80,068
Non-Equity Incentive Plan$808,794
Salary$450,000
Other$10,006
Total$1,348,868

Demeter received $808.8K in non-equity incentive plan, accounting for 60% of the total pay in 2018.

Demeter also received $80.1K of change in pension value and nonqualified deferred compensation earnings, $450K in salary and $10K in other compensation.

Rankings

In 2018, Denise M. Demeter's compensation ranked 7,681st out of 14,244 executives tracked by ExecPay. In other words, Demeter earned more than 46.1% of executives.
